Hmm. That's an interesting concept. There's some evidence that
people feel better about their choices when they don't have so many
--that having lots of choice tends to lead to regret about the choices not taken.
On the other hand, I wonder if this contributes to the version of tall poppy syndrome that I'm told is common in Scandinavia...
